The Curly Texture Spectrum
Before we dive into styles, let's get real about curl types. That 3A/3B/4C system? Helpful but incomplete. Your actual styling options depend more on these factors:
Factor | Impact on Styles | My Personal Experience |
---|---|---|
Density (hairs per sq inch) | Determines if layers will look full or sparse | My medium-density hair turns wispy with too many layers |
Strand thickness | Fine hair struggles with heavy products; coarse hair can handle more | My fine curls get weighed down by shea butter (learned that the hard way!) |
Porosity | High porosity soaks up product; low porosity needs lighter formulas | My high-porosity curls drink leave-in conditioner like water |

Curly Hair FAQs: Real Talk Edition
Q: How often should I cut medium length curly hair?
Every 12-16 weeks. But watch for these signs: ends feel crunchy even after conditioning, styles won't hold shape, constant tangling at ends. I push to 5 months sometimes but regret it every time.
Q: What's the best layers for mid-length curly hair?
Shaggy layers if density is high; rounded layers if hair is thinner. My stylist does "collarbone-skimming face-framers" – 2-inch pieces that blend perfectly with my 3B curls.
Q: Can I air dry mid-length curly hair?
Absolutely! But section hair into 4 parts and apply product evenly. I air dry 70% then diffuse roots for volume. Takes 2.5 hours versus 4 for full air dry.
Seasonal Adjustments That Matter
Your hairstyles for mid length curly hair need to adapt to weather:
Season | Biggest Challenge | Style Solution | Product Swap |
---|---|---|---|
Summer | Humidity frizz | High buns with face-framing tendrils | Gels > creams |
Winter | Dryness & static | Deep side parts with moisture-sealing styles | Add leave-in conditioner |
Last winter I learned the hard way: wool scarves + dry curls = massive static. Now I always spritz my scarves with static guard before wrapping!
Curly Hair Maintenance Schedule
Consistency beats perfection with medium length curly hairstyles. Here's my actual routine:
- Daily: Satin pillowcase, refresh with water/aloe mix
- Twice weekly: Detangle in shower with conditioner
- Weekly: Clarify (I use Suave Daily Clarifying $2)
- Monthly: Protein treatment (DIY gelatin mask $1)
- Quarterly: Dust ends at salon
The biggest game-changer? Stopping daily washing. My scalp needed 6 weeks to adjust but now I wash just twice weekly. Greasy phase was brutal though!

Texture-Specific Cutting Techniques
Not all curls are cut equal. What works for my 3B hair might fail for tighter textures:
For Type 3 Curls
Best: DevaCut-inspired dry cutting
Style: Defined layers starting at cheekbone
Warning: Avoid blunt cuts unless density is high
For Type 4 Curls
Best: Stretched cutting technique
Style: Geometric shapes with tapered neckline
Essential: Moisture BEFORE cutting to prevent shrinkage shock
My friend with 4C hair taught me this: always stretch sections while cutting to anticipate shrinkage. Her hairstyles for mid length curly hair last months longer now.
